Restoring Childhood Spaces with Safety in Mind
Kids use their furniture far differently than adults do — they climb, jump, pull, drag, and move pieces constantly. This results in weakened joints, wobbly structures, broken drawers, and damaged surfaces. Our repair service is specially designed around the way children actually use furniture: actively, energetically, and unpredictably.
We begin with a full safety assessment, checking the stability of the bed frame, the strength of ladder steps on bunk beds, the alignment of drawers, the sturdiness of study desks, and the balance of chairs. Children’s rooms should never have sharp edges, loose screws, unstable structures, or splintered wood — so we eliminate every risk.
From replacing worn wooden slats to strengthening metal supports, we rebuild each piece to handle daily use. Study desks and chairs get reinforced so homework time becomes comfortable and safe. Toy storage units get repaired so they function smoothly and don’t trap little fingers. Wardrobes, dressers, and bookshelves are stabilized to prevent tipping, ensuring maximum safety in your child’s environment.
Kids’ furniture repairs aren’t just cosmetic — they are essential for creating a secure space where your child can grow, learn, play, and rest without worry.

Repairing Bunk Beds, Study Desks, Chairs & Storage Units with Precision and Care
Every piece in a child’s room has a role — and we treat each one with attention to detail. Bunk beds, for example, require the highest level of safety. Loose guard rails, unstable ladders, cracked steps, or squeaky movement can turn dangerous if not repaired promptly. We tighten every joint, reinforce the frame, and re-secure all hardware so the bed remains stable even during active use.
Study desks and chairs often suffer from uneven legs, scratched surfaces, broken hinges, or wobbly frames. We restore them so they are comfortable and durable enough for long study sessions. Drawers glide smoothly again, desk surfaces are refinished, and structural issues are corrected completely.
Toy storage boxes, shelves, and cabinets frequently loosen or break due to overloading. We rebuild the internal supports, fix door alignment, strengthen hinges, and replace weak panels so the storage becomes safer and more functional.
Children’s rooms should feel warm, organized, and reliable — and that’s exactly what our repairs deliver. We aim to extend the life of every item while ensuring it meets safety standards and looks great in your child’s space.

Frequently Asked Questions
What types of bunk bed problems can you fix?
Bunk beds often suffer from loose frames, unstable ladders, cracked slats, and weak guard rails. We reinforce the frame, secure all joints, replace damaged parts, and stabilize the entire structure to ensure it is completely safe for daily use.
How do you improve the safety of kids’ storage furniture?
Storage furniture in children’s rooms can loosen over time due to overloading or rough handling. We strengthen internal supports, adjust hinges, secure the back panels, and ensure doors or drawers open smoothly without posing any injury risk.
Can you repair study desks that are heavily scratched or unstable?
Study desks often experience scratches, shaky legs, broken hinges, or weakened frames. We refinish surfaces, replace hardware, tighten the structure, and rebuild support areas so the desk becomes stable, functional, and comfortable again.
Do you handle repairs for plastic or mixed-material kids’ furniture?
Many children’s pieces are made from a combination of wood, plastic, and metal. We handle all these materials by using the appropriate repair methods, ensuring each part is reinforced and safe enough to withstand long-term use.
What if my child’s chair or table has uneven legs or feels unstable?
Uneven furniture in kids’ rooms can cause falls or discomfort. We correct alignment issues, reinforce the legs, replace damaged components, and restore balance so the furniture sits perfectly stable on the floor.
